What is Cannabis Extract?
Cannabis extract refers to a concentrated substance derived from the cannabis plant. These extracts are created through various extraction processes that pull out the active compounds, leaving behind the plant material. Cannabis extracts are known for their potency and are used in a wide array of products, from oils to edibles, providing users with specific cannabinoids like THC and CBD.
How is Cannabis Extract Produced?
The production of cannabis extracts involves several methods, each designed to isolate desired components of the plant such as terpenes and cannabinoids. One common technique is solvent extraction, where solvents like ethanol or CO2 are used to separate the active ingredients from the plant material. Another method is mechanical extraction, which may include dry sifting or using pressure and heat to obtain the resin without solvents. These processes ensure that the resulting extract is potent and free of contaminants.
Types of Cannabis Extracts
There are various forms of cannabis extracts available, each with unique properties and uses. Some of the most common types include:
Concentrates: This category includes various products like wax, shatter, and budder, known for their high THC levels. These are often consumed via dabbing, vaping, or as an ingredient in edibles.
Oils: Cannabis oils are typically consumed orally or sublingually. They may contain high levels of either THC or CBD, making them suitable for both recreational and medicinal use.
Tinctures: These are alcohol-based extracts that are typically taken by placing a few drops under the tongue, offering a discreet way to consume cannabis.
Legal Considerations in the UK
In the UK, cannabis is classified as a Class B controlled drug under the Misuse of Drugs Act 1971. However, certain cannabis products, especially those high in CBD and low in THC, are legally available. Legal cannabis extracts must adhere to THC concentration limits and are usually derived from industrial hemp. Products containing higher levels of THC are generally prohibited unless prescribed by a doctor for medical purposes.
Potential Benefits and Uses
Many users report various therapeutic benefits from cannabis extracts, particularly those containing CBD. These include relief from pain, inflammation, anxiety, and certain seizure disorders. However, the efficacy of cannabis extracts can vary based on individual health conditions, the type of extract, and its usage. It is important for users to consult healthcare professionals before using cannabis extracts for therapeutic purposes.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is cannabis extract?
Cannabis extract refers to a concentrated form of cannabis that is made by using solvents or mechanical methods to extract cannabinoids and other compounds from the cannabis plant.
How is cannabis extract different from cannabis flower?
Cannabis extract is a concentrated form of the plant’s active compounds, while cannabis flower is the raw, dried blossom of the plant.
What compounds are found in cannabis extract?
Cannabis extract typically contains cannabinoids like THC and CBD, terpenes, and other phytochemicals present in the plant.
What are common methods for making cannabis extract?
Common extraction methods include solvent-based extraction (using CO2, butane, or ethanol) and solventless methods (using heat and pressure).
Is cannabis extract legal?
The legality of cannabis extract varies by country and region, with many places having specific regulations for medical and recreational use.
What are the uses of cannabis extract?
Cannabis extract is used for medical purposes, recreational consumption, and as an ingredient in edibles, topicals, and vape cartridges.
Are there different types of cannabis extracts?
Yes, some types include oils, shatter, wax, rosin, and tinctures, each having varying consistencies, potencies, and methods of consumption.
What is the consistency of cannabis extract?
Consistency can vary widely, from liquid oils to solid forms like shatter or wax, depending on the extraction method and processing.
How potent is cannabis extract?
Cannabis extracts are typically more potent than the raw plant, having higher concentrations of THC and CBD.
Can you ingest cannabis extract directly?
Some extracts like tinctures and oils can be ingested directly, while others, such as wax or shatter, are typically vaporized or dabbed.
What is dabbing in the context of cannabis extracts?
Dabbing is a method of consuming cannabis concentrates using a dab rig. It involves applying the extract to a hot surface and inhaling the resulting vapor.
Are there health benefits to using cannabis extract?
Cannabis extracts may offer health benefits for conditions like chronic pain, epilepsy, and anxiety, but research is ongoing.
What are the risks associated with cannabis extract usage?
Risks include psychoactive effects, dependency, and potential for consuming impurities if the extract is not produced properly.
How is cannabis oil different from other extracts?
Cannabis oil is a liquid extract that is often used for oral consumption or topicals, whereas other extracts like shatter and wax are more solid and used for dabbing or vaping.
What role do terpenes play in cannabis extracts?
Terpenes contribute to the aroma and flavor of cannabis extracts and may have synergistic effects with cannabinoids, affecting the overall experience.
Can you make cannabis extract at home?
While possible, making cannabis extract at home can be dangerous without proper equipment and knowledge of the extraction process.
How should cannabis extract be stored?
Cannabis extract should be stored in a cool, dark place in airtight containers to maintain potency and prevent degradation.
What is the difference between full-spectrum and isolate extracts?
Full-spectrum extracts contain a wide range of cannabinoids and terpenes, while isolates contain only one cannabinoid, usually CBD or THC.
How can I ensure the quality and safety of cannabis extract?
Look for lab-tested products and purchase from reputable suppliers to ensure the extract is free from contaminants and labeled accurately.
What is the entourage effect in relation to cannabis extracts?
The entourage effect refers to the synergistic interaction of cannabinoids, terpenes, and other compounds in cannabis, thought to enhance therapeutic effects.
